Output 58f62b467b1cf590f974477c85c80325d5f988ad31d9186e58cc5896032cf692:1

value
1708700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f47288d51ec51ea6a3141971838ec1979678bbaf OP_EQUAL
address
3PyY1M5r8yGwn5LBM4xqCdmCHYRoum4D7N
transaction
58f62b467b1cf590f974477c85c80325d5f988ad31d9186e58cc5896032cf692
spent
true